DISMISSED

On April 15, 2003, we abated this appeal for an abandonment hearing pursuant to rules 37.3(a)(2) and 38.8(b)(2) of the Texas Rules of Appellate Procedure. The trial court held the hearing on June 23, 2003. The trial court appointed counsel to consult with and advise appellant regarding the pending appeal. (1) The trial court then found that appellant did not wish to prosecute his appeal. Accordingly, this appeal is dismissed.
